Brian Grant Organizes Parkinson’s Fundraising Event

Portland, Oregon, Feb 19, (THAINDIAN NEWS) A fundraiser event has been scheduled to be held at Portland in Oregon this summer. The date and the venue of the event, along with the program lineup, has been declared. It is going to be organized by the former basketball star Brian Grant, along with Michael J. Fox. The event is going to be held in order to raise sufficient funds for the Michael J. Fox Foundation, which is one of the leading foundations that deal with the raising awareness and funding of the research of the deadly Parkinson’s disease. Brian Grant himself is a victim of the Parkinson’s disease, and hence he seems to be just the right person to organize the event.
The event is going to be held at the Rose Garden at the in Portland in Oregon. The event, which will be held for two days, will include a dinner at the Rose Garden, on August 1. A golf event will also take place at the Pumpkin Ridge the next day. The organizers have lined up Pat Riley as the speaker in the event. A number of other stars have also been scheduled to make an appearance at the event, like Muhammad Ali, who has had a long association with Brian Grant. The others who have been scheduled to appear are Bill Russel, Julius Erving and Bill Wanton.
Brian Grant’s association with the Michael J. Fox Foundation dates back to 2009, when he had just been diagnosed with the deadly Parkinson’s Disease. After receiving the prognosis, he made a public declaration of his illness, thanks to the encouragement of Michael J. Fox himself, along with boxing star Muhammad Ali.
